In the following sequence of reaction
`CH_(3)CH_(2)COCloverset(AlCl_(3))rarrAunderset("conc."HCl,"Heat")overset(Zn(Hg))rarrB`
the product B is :

A

`PhCOCH_(2)CH_(3)`

B

`PhCHOHCH_(2)CH_(3)`

C

`PhCH_(2)CH_(2)CH_(3)`

D

`PhCH=CHCH_(3)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
